Description The commissioned Police Officer position protects life and property, enforces laws and ordinances, preserves the peace, and prevents and investigates crimes. This position is responsible to recognize the social importance of police functions, for tactful and courteous treatment of the public, and for conscientious and efficient performance of duties under general supervision. Essential Duties Enforce tribal, federal, state and local laws. Respond to non-emergency and emergency complaints and matters of a criminal and civil nature. Patrol assigned areas, make arrests, issue citations, transport prisoners, complete crime reports, and handle related records management. Interpret and apply modern principles, practices, and procedures of police work. Resolve a variety of potentially volatile and dangerous situations in a calm, professional, and effective manner. Train and use firearms safely in accordance with departmental rules. Understand and carry out oral and written instructions. Write clear and comprehensive reports. Additional Duties Drive a patrol car under normal and adverse conditions. Apply knowledge of basic first aid procedures. Clean and maintain assigned firearms and vehicles. Work with the public and coworkers in a professional and courteous manner. Perform duties from time to time that may not be related to regular responsibilities, as required by the Tribe’s commitment to community service. Other duties as assigned. Requirements Knowledge of the criminal justice system and principles, practices, and procedures of police work. Demonstrated ability to communicate effectively verbally and in writing. Demonstrated ability to analyze situations and adopt a quick, effective and appropriate course of action. Proficiency with MS Office programs. Education & Experience Education Required High School Diploma or GED Education Preferred Associates or bachelor’s degree in criminal justice or related field Experience 1 or more years’ experience in security or corrections preferred. Other service-related job experience is highly preferred. Certifications/Licenses Must have and maintain a valid WA state driver’s license without restrictions. Current 1st Aid/CPR certification or ability to obtain by date of hire. Other Requirements Must be able to pass an extensive criminal background check (SF86 Background check). Must agree to be subject to the Tribe's Controlled Substance and Alcohol Testing Policy, including pre-employment screening. Must pass the physical requirements of the state as well as the standard psychiatric test. Graduation from the United States Indian Police Academy and the Washington State Criminal Justice Training Commission’s 2‑week basic law enforcement equivalency academy. Experienced and Lateral Officers – must have completed a WA state‑recognized basic law enforcement academy and possess or can obtain a Washington State Training Commission Peace Officer Certification. Must complete all mandatory WA state and BIA certification and in‑service training. Must be able to work shift work to include days, nights, weekends, and holidays. Work Environment Work is performed both indoors, in vehicles and outdoors. It can be physically demanding, stressful, and dangerous. Officers must be alert and ready to react throughout their entire shift, and regularly work at crime and accident scenes and encounter suffering and the results of violence. Tribal Preference The Snoqualmie Indian Tribe follows the Tribal Hiring Preference as outlined in tribal policies, including the Tribal Employment Rights Ordinance (TERO). TERO sets forth certain hiring preferences for qualified individuals who are enrolled in a federally recognized Indian tribe, as well as, in some cases, preference for certain family members of those individuals.
